
Old Javanese motto of “Bhinneka Tunggal Ika” meaning “unity in multiplicity, Indonesia is a country that involves of 17, 508 islands. It is specifically situated in the south eastern part of Asia named as the largest archipelago in a global scale and ranked number four as the world’s most populous country. Dominantly inhabited by Muslims,…

Read More